Subject: Pilot with Harrowby Stores — Update

To the executive team, copied to branch managers. The Harrowby Stores pilot runs across six locations starting next month. Stock of the Lintvale range ships this week. Branch managers: report weekly sell-through to regional ops. Signage and staff briefings due by Friday. No public comment until Harrowby confirms. Success criteria: sell-through above 60% and repeat orders by week eight. The line below is confidential; do not forward.

confidential, kajof-tahof: The pricing group signed off on a budget of $491.8 million for Project Casvan.

Several external plugin authors have reported that uploads to the SproutCycle scheduler marketplace fail with SIGNATURE_MISMATCH since the 3.2 rollout. Investigation shows our verifier now requires manifests signed against the updated trust root, while older tooling still references the retired chain. Please re-sign your plugin bundles before resubmitting; unsigned or legacy-signed packages will be rejected automatically. For convenience during the transition, the current marketplace signing key is included below.

signing key of fajof-tagag = bky3_rJk

Q: Why do we still see duplicate customer records after the Mergewell rollout?

Short version: the matcher only dedupes on exact normalized email plus fuzzy name right now. Phone-only records slip through. Phase two adds phone and address blocking — targeting next sprint. Don't hand-merge in prod; it breaks lineage. If you spot a nasty duplicate cluster, flag it to the identity team by mail.

escalation mailbox, bafog-fafog: ulador@paliqlabs.internal

When customers report the Quillgate sync agent refusing new connections, suspect leaked file descriptors. Ask for the agent's descriptor count from the diagnostics panel; anything above 8,000 on default limits means the leak is active. The usual culprit is the retry loop opening sockets without closing on DNS failure. Collect the diagnostics bundle before restarting, since the restart clears the evidence. Attach the bundle alongside the agent build identifier printed below.

session token of kageg-tahop = htk14_af3c1ccccb7dcf